Contrary to the name, this beer is far from basic. We mashed in with pumpkin, boiled with pumpkin and even "dry-hopped" with pumpkin but the addition of the medley of fall spices and Dawson Taylor cold-pressed coffee you may start to feel like you're at your local coffee shop enjoying the flavors of the Fall. An addition of lactose sugar gives the beer a hint of sweetness to enhance to cinnamon sticks steeped in the mash and compliment the coffee. It's the flavors you crave this time of year.

On nitro at brewery. Initial burst of aroma is spicy, savory peppery, nutmeg. Dark ruby/amber with creamy head. More of the fall spice comes out in the flavor, not as spicy as aroma hints at. Finishes kind of flat though.

Crowler from the taproom tonight for $8... Pours slightly hazed amber red... lightly spicy with some background coffee.. a mild sweetness helps tie things together... Pretty good... One of the better pumpkin beer concepts I've had this year... I personally would like a beer that is not so watery.
